一.PTA实验报告
一.7-1查找书籍

1.设计思路:先用一个结构体保存所有图书的信息,再输入查找的书籍数目,再根据输入的信息在结构体内部进行比较,找到价格最高和最低的书籍信息。

 

2.本题pta提交列表

3.代码截屏

 

4.本题调试中遇到的问题

 

读入的时候如果存在空格的话会运行出现问题,需要在n的输入后加入getchar()。

二.PTA找出总分最高的学生

1.设计思路;先定义一个结构体,使用一个循环把学号姓名,分数分别输进去,在结构体内部进行比较找到总分最高的学生,再将他的信息进行输出

 

2.本题pta提交列表

 

3.本题代码

 

4.本题调试中遇到的错误

 

三.PTA7-2通讯录排序

1.设计思路:定义个结构体,使用第一个循环输入信息,第二个循环将生日信息的时间进行比较,再进行排序,依次按照生日输出信息。

2.本题pta提交列表

 

3.本题代码

 

4.本题调试中遇到的问题

 

 

这题在提交过程中出现了逻辑错误,后来重新打了一遍。

二.同学互评

我的代码

 

互评同学:黄月浩

 

我和黄月浩同学的代码很相似。大体的思路是一样的。

三.本周pta最后排名

 

四.学习总结

1,.结构体的运用可以单独处理结构内部的变量。

2.指针也可以指向结构变量。用*p访问结构成员。

3.不足:结构数组和结构指针的使用比较少,使用的时候出现的错误也比较多.数据类型和结构变量的定义比较混淆。

 

posted on 2018-01-20 16:36  Noko  阅读(171)  评论(1编辑  收藏  举报